The Arizona heat combined with a rear engine of the Porsche 996 makes for an unhappy car. High engine temperatures rapes power from any car. There is only 2 ways to overcome this problem. First, move the hell out of Arizona. Second, get Porsche's factory 3rd radiator kit for your 996 Carrera. The first seems like a great deal, but I can't. The second is about $600ish, but makes a huge difference in life.

The 3rd radiator kit fits in the center of your front bumper to get direct cooling on a larger volume then just the 2 side radiators. The kit includes the radiator, adapter hoses, brackets, bumper duct, and all hardware necessary to add on to your car.

The fitment of Porsche's 3rd Radiator is time consuming. You need to remove the bumper, drain the coolant, take off existing lines, and more. Once this is complete, bolting up the new pieces and getting the parts in place is simple. The total install time is about 3 hours.

After we filled the coolant back up and checked for leaks, we put the bumper back on and took the car for a drive. Ripping it around, turning the AC off, leaving the car on at idle, it just stayed cool! Overall, it was about a 20 or 30 degree difference when check with our AutoEnginuity scan tool. Overall impression... This is a must have for road racers or drivers in hot climates. It is manadatory to run with forced induction and the improvement in engine cooling should make it mandatory for everyone!
